Anyway, her The Authority fanfic is awesome. Love it to bits *huggles it* So, you're probably asking yourself who The Authority are? If so, they're from the DC/Wildstorm stable, group of superheros who well, save the world. But aren't afraid to kill the bad guys. Two of the team are gay, Apollo and The Midnighter, which is always fun :) Planetary has the occasional tie-in with The Authority, if that helps.

Legend. Epic Iron Maiden AU. Slash. Set in England during the time of Viking raids. Err. So pre-1066 I think? God, I should revise my history sometime. Anyhoo... fantastic story and awesome characterisations. Andy is a wordy writer but uses them all to create a vivid world and a beautifully told story. One of my favourites, and you don't need to know anything about Iron Maiden to enjoy it!
